1.A 3phase 5MVA 6.6 KV alternator with a reactance of 8% is connected to a feeder of series
impedance0.12+j0.48 Ω/km.The transformer is rated at 3 MVA 6.6kV/33 KV and has a
reactance of 5%.Determinethe fault current supplied by the generator operating under no load
with a voltage of 6.9 KV, when a 3phase symmetrical fault occurs at a point 15 Km along the
feeder.(6)(M/J-2012).(N/D-2016)- Refer Page no-SQ.20

4.Two generators are connected in parallel to the low voltage side of a 3phase delta star
transformer as shown in figure 2. Generator 1 is rated 60,000KVA, 11KV. Generator 2 is rated
30,000 KVA, 11Kv. Each generator has a sub transient reactance of X d”= 25%. The transformer
is rated 90,000 KVA at 11kv-∆/66kv- Ү with a reactance of 10%. Before a fault occurred, the
transformer is unloaded and there is no circulating current between the generators. Find the sub
transient current in each generator when a three phase fault occurs on the hv side of the
transformer.(6) (A/M-2015)

8.Generator G1 and G2 are identical and rated 11Kv, 20 MVA and have a transient
reactance of 0.25pu at own MVA base. The transformer T1 and T2 are also identical and
are rated 11/66KV, 5MVA and have a reactance of 0.06pu to their own MVA base. A 50km
long transmission line is connected between the two generators has a reactance of
0.92ohm/km. Calculate three phase fault current, when fault occurs at middle of the line as
shown in figure. (8)(CO3-M)

16. A synchronous generator and motor are rated 30 MVA, 13.2 KV and both have sub transient
reactance of 20 %.The line connecting them has reactance of 10% on the base of machine
ratings. The motor is drawing 20,000 KW at 0.8 p.f leading and terminal voltage of 12.8 KV
when a symmetrical 3 phase fault occurs at the motor terminals. Find the sub transient current in
the generator, motor and fault by using internal voltages of machines.( May 2013) (Nov 2015)-
